Zoo Quest to Madagascar is the full account of David Attenborough's time travelling throughout Madagascar to film remarkable animals which live nowhere else in the world: spectacular chameleons nearly three feet in length; geckos so well camouflaged they are almost impossible to find; millipedes the size of golf-balls. But the principal objective of the expedition was to film and observe lemurs, seeing brown lemurs, gentle lemurs, ruffed lemurs, ringed lemurs and mouse lemurs. The Zoo Quest series details David Attenborough's early expeditions of, setting him on his path as the world's most widely viewed documentarian of natural history and a much-loved British national treasure. As part of the ground-breaking 1954 BBC television series developed in association with London Zoo, which would form the basis for the documentary work that would later propel him to global acclaim, the Zoo Quest books presents Attenborough's earliest accounts of expeditions to far-flung regions in Latin America, Asia, and Oceania.In this collection, you will read a young Attenborough as he traverses distant lands, meets local peoples, and of course as he comes into contact with all manner of wildlife. To read Zoo Quest is to catch a glimpse of how the world's foremost conservationist began his career. The books display his characteristic charm and concern for all things natural, offering the reader not only a greater appreciation for and understanding of Attenborough, but also of nature and the world.
